This Date in Weather History

1985 - A tropical wave, later to become Tropical Storm Isabel, struck Puerto Rico. As much as 24 inches of rain fell in 24 hours, and the severe flooding and numerous landslides resulting from the rain claimed about 180 lives.

About Post Mills, Vermont

Post Mills is an unincorporated community in the town of Thetford, Orange County, Vermont, United States.
